POST-TREATMENT CARE
Looking after your skin after a facial
There is no downtime following a facial. These steps help protect the work done in your session and keep your skin in good condition between appointments.
Stay well hydrated
Drink plenty of water in the days following treatment to support your skin’s hydration from within.
SPF every day
Apply a broad-spectrum SPF to protect your freshly treated skin. UV protection also helps maintain any improvement in skin tone over time.
No exfoliants for 48 hours
Avoid retinol, AHAs, BHAs, and physical scrubs for 48 hours. Your skin has just been through a proper exfoliation session.
Gentle products for 24 to 48 hours
Use a mild, fragrance-free cleanser and moisturiser. Keep your routine simple while your skin settles after treatment.
Wait 24 hours before makeup
Allow your skin at least 24 hours before applying makeup, particularly heavy foundation or products with active ingredients.

WHAT TO EXPECT AFTER TREATMENT
Our signature facials are designed to have little to no recovery period. Most clients leave with skin that feels cleaner and more settled than when they arrived. Some mild redness or sensitivity may occur, particularly following extractions in the Better or Best tiers, and typically settles within a few hours.
For clients with sensitive or reactive skin, let your nurse know at the start of your appointment. The signature facial option and the approach used will be adjusted accordingly.
If you are booking a facial before an event, booking 3 to 5 days before rather than the day before is recommended. This gives any mild redness time to settle so your skin is looking its best on the day.
